"Efforts to Repay Loans Affected by War"
I hold accounts with both Mintos and PeerBerry. Ever since the conflict in Ukraine started, my Mintos investments have seen a ton of loans go into default, and I doubt I'll ever get that money back. On the flip side, my experience with PeerBerry has been different; my average return on investment has dipped from 11% to 9%, but I haven't encountered any defaulted loans yet. Out of the 6k I put into areas impacted by the war, over 3k has been returned to me. Honestly, if I had thrown that 6k into another platform, I would’ve been in deep trouble. It’s pretty impressive how PeerBerry has pulled this off with the help of its partners.

"Top P2P Platform in My Portfolio"
I've got my hands in five P2P platforms, and I gotta say, Peerberry stands out as my favorite. Sure, they ain't flawless and have made some blunders, but they really know how to keep in touch with everyday investors.
Pros:
- Their Telegram updates are top-notch!
- The returns are solid.
- The way they handled the loans stuck in Russia and Ukraine is a real standout in the P2P scene.
- They didn’t pull the 'force majeure' card because of the conflict.
- The website is pretty slick and easy to navigate.
Cons:
- The management took a big risk by heavily investing in Ukraine and Russia, which ended up putting the company at risk. What seemed like a good move back then turned into a potential problem later on. The delay in responding to the political changes (like pulling capital from RU & UKR) was the real issue, not the investments themselves!
- They claim to have settled over half of the overdue loans from Ukraine and Russia, but the reality varies across different portfolios. It all depends on how you interpret the figures and what you count as part of the original amount.
- They’ve made partial repayments on loans from Ukraine and Russia, but considering the losses (I see Ukrainian loans as nearly a total loss), this could impact the overall financial health of the group. If they can’t sell the Russian assets for a fair price or recover some funds from there, they might run into some serious financial trouble.
In summary:
Peerberry is definitely my top pick for P2P investments, with excellent communication for investors. However, I’d keep an eye on their financial stability in the mid to long term.
